  • Cocoon 3 is Here and It’s Evolving into Something Great: Whether that’s known entities like Beacon and Console Launcher, or upcoming sleepers like Wave Launcher, we’re headed towards the land of a frontend for everyone. But right now at the forefront of playful aesthetics seems to be Cocoon Shell, and as of today, they’ve dropped their 3.0 release and it’s built from the ground up.
  • You Can Play Animal Crossing on Your Clamshell with This Decompilation: What if you wanted to play Animal Crossing on the go, and as portably as possible. While you could pull out your Switch or 3DS for New Horizons or New Leaf, why not go older, and even smaller. Thanks to this decompilation of Animal Crossing you can now play this Gamecube classic on your H700 line of handhelds! With a catch.
  • Virtua Racing is Back and Better Than Ever Thanks to this Port: Were you a fan of Virtua Racing on the Genesis/Mega Drive? Were you aware that it was originally from the Sega Model 1; their Arcade Machines from the 90’s. Well if you were, and you wanted even more gameplay on a classic F1 styled racing game it looks like you’re in luck. Because thanks to some more incredible work from within the community, you can now play the classic Model 1 Virtua Racing game again; with a lot more packed in than there ever was before.

TrimUI Brick Pro First Impressions: Bigger, Better, but Not Without Issues | Retro Handhelds
After a few hours with the TrimUI Brick Pro, its larger display and comfort stand out, but it may be too big to become the perfect EDC handheld.
